Kliknij na poniższy przycisk aby zobaczyć jak to działa...
Oto kod powyższego przycisku do otwierania nowego okna:
&l6;! x> sk7yp6 ze s67ony in6e7ne6owej ELIDE7.PL x> &g6;
&l6;sc7ip6 l1ngu1ge=&quo6;J1v1Sc7ip6&quo6;&g6;
cfxunc6ion WinOpen{}
{
msg=open{&quo6;&quo6;,&quo6;Displ1yWindow&quo6;,&quo6;6oolb17=no,di7ec6o7ies=no,menub17=no&quo6;};
msg.documen6.6{&quo6;&l6;26ml&g6;&l6;2e1d&g6;&l6;6i6le&g6;Nowe Okno w J1v1 sc7ip6&l6;/6i6le&g6;&l6;/2e1d&g6;&l6;body&g6;&quo6;};
msg.documen6.6{&quo6;&l6;cen6e7&g6;&l6;21&g6;O6o now1 s67on1 z kodem uk7y6ym w sk7ypcie!&l6;/21&g6; ... &l6;s67ong&g6;możn1 6o z1s6osow1ć n1 wiele sposobów... 67zeb1 p1mię61ć , że w kodzie nie może być zn1ków p7zejści1 do nowej linii {zn1ków En6e7}&l6;/s67ong&g6;&l6;/cen6e7&g6;&l6;/body&g6;&l6;/26ml&g6;&quo6;};
}
&l6;/sc7ip6&g6;
&l6;cfxo7m&g6;
&l6;in1 6ype=&quo6;bu66on&quo6; n1me=&quo6;Bu66on1&quo6; v1lue=&quo6;Pok1ż nowe okno&quo6; onclick=&quo6;WinOpen{}&quo6;&g6;
&l6;/cfxo7m&g6;
Taki prosty przycisk można zastosować w wielu sytuacjach. Wystarczy tylko zmienić tekst w instrukcji document.write w powyższym kodzie. Pamiętajmy, że ta instrukcja nie działa jeśli w kodzie będą znaki entera...
A jak zastosować to w sposób bardziej profesjonalny z użyciem kodu PHP.
&l4;?p1p
x> sk2yp4 ze s42ony in4e2ne4owej ELIDE2.PL
x> decfxiniujemy ścieżkę do pliku k4ó2y m0 być wyświe4l0ny w okienku JS
7sciezk0-do-pliku-z-42esci0-14ml = 'k040log/plik-z-42esci0.14ml';
x> czy40my z0w024ość pliku w 14ml i z0pisujemy go do zmiennej o n0zwie 7co-wyswie4l0my
7co-wyswie4l0my = cfxile-ge4-con4en4s{'7sciezk0-do-pliku-z-42esci0-14ml'};
x> wy2zuc0my p2zejści0 do nowej linii we wszys4kic1 możliwyc1 opcj0c1
x> z0mieni0my je n0 sp0cje
7co-wyswie4l0my = s42-2epl0ce{&quo4;\2&quo4;,' ',7co-wyswie4l0my};
7co-wyswie4l0my = s42-2epl0ce{&quo4;\n&quo4;,' ',7co-wyswie4l0my};
?&g4;
&l4;sc2ip4 l0ngu0ge=&quo4;J0v0Sc2ip4&quo4;&g4;
cfxunc4ion WinOpen{}
{
msg=open{&quo4;&quo4;,&quo4;Displ0yWindow&quo4;,&quo4;4oolb02=no,di2ec4o2ies=no,menub02=no&quo4;};
msg.documen4.0{&quo4;&l4;14ml&g4;&l4;1e0d&g4;&l4;4i4le&g4;Nowe Okno w J0v0 sc2ip4&l4;/4i4le&g4;&l4;/1e0d&g4;&l4;body&g4;&quo4;};
msg.documen4.0{&quo4;&l4;?p1p ec1o 7co-wyswie4l0my; ?&g4;&quo4;};
}
&l4;/sc2ip4&g4;
&l4;cfxo2m&g4;
&l4;in0 4ype=&quo4;bu44on&quo4; n0me=&quo4;Bu44on1&quo4; v0lue=&quo4;Pok0ż nowe okno&quo4; onclick=&quo4;WinOpen{}&quo4;&g4;
&l4;/cfxo2m&g4;
Ten skrypt pobiera zwykłą stronę w htmlu i już nie wymaga pisania kodu bez przejść do nowych linii. Sam konwertuje kod strony do postaci działającej w JS.